Ingredients


– 1 pound fresh asparagus, trimmed
– 2 tablespoons unsalted butter
– 2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
– 1 cup whole milk
– 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
– ½ cup grated Parmesan cheese
– 1 teaspoon salt
– ½ teaspoon black pepper
– ¼ teaspoon garlic powder
– ¼ teaspoon onion powder
– ½ cup breadcrumbs (optional)

Step-by-Step Instructions


Creating Asparagus Au Gratin is a straightforward process. Follow these steps for a delightful outcome:
1. Preheat Oven: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
2. Prepare Asparagus: Blanch the asparagus in boiling water for 2-3 minutes until bright green. Drain and rinse under cold water to stop the cooking process.
3. Make the Sauce: In a saucepan, melt the butter over medium heat. Add the flour, stirring for about 1 minute until it forms a paste. Gradually add milk, whisking continuously until the mixture thickens.
4. Add Cheese: Remove the pan from heat and stir in the cheddar and Parmesan cheese until melted. Add salt, pepper, garlic powder, and onion powder. Mix well.
5. Combine Ingredients: In a baking dish, layer the blanched asparagus and pour the cheese sauce over the top, making sure the asparagus is well-coated.
6. Add Breadcrumbs (Optional): If desired, sprinkle breadcrumbs on top for an extra crunchy layer.
7. Bake: Bake in the preheated oven for 25-30 minutes or until the top is bubbling and golden brown.

Additional Tips


Use Fresh Asparagus: For the best flavor and texture, choose fresh asparagus stalks. Look for bright green and firm spears.
Experiment with Cheeses: While cheddar and Parmesan are traditional, feel free to experiment with other cheeses like Gruyère or goat cheese for a unique flavor.
Adjust for Spice: Add a pinch of cayenne pepper or a sprinkle of crushed red pepper flakes to the cheese sauce to give it a little kick.
Add Vegetables: Incorporate other vegetables such as mushrooms, sun-dried tomatoes, or spinach into the dish for a more colorful presentation and added nutrients.

Recipe Variation


There are many ways to tailor Asparagus Au Gratin to your taste. Here are some ideas:
1. Bacon Lovers: Incorporate crispy, chopped bacon into the cheese sauce for a savory, smoky flavor that complements the asparagus beautifully.
2. Gluten-Free Option: Use gluten-free breadcrumbs or skip them altogether for a smooth creamy top without compromising flavor.
3. Herb Infusion: Mix in fresh herbs such as dill, thyme, or basil into the cheese sauce for an aromatic twist.
4. Rich and Creamy: For an ultra-creamy version, replace whole milk with heavy cream or half-and-half in the cheese sauce.

Freezing and Storage


Storage: After cooking, allow the Asparagus Au Gratin to cool completely before storing. Keep it in an airtight container in the refrigerator. It will last for about 3-4 days.
Freezing: You can freeze Asparagus Au Gratin before or after baking. Ensure it is in a well-sealed, freezer-safe container. It can be frozen for up to 2-3 months. To reheat baked gratin, warm it in the oven until heated through.

Frequently Asked Questions


Can I use frozen asparagus instead of fresh?
Yes, but be aware that frozen asparagus may have a softer texture once cooked. Thaw and drain it well before using.
How can I make this dish ahead of time?
You can prepare the cheese sauce and blanch the asparagus in advance. Store them separately and combine just before baking.
Is there a dairy-free version of Asparagus Au Gratin?
Absolutely! Substitute dairy products with plant-based alternatives, such as almond milk and vegan cheese.
What can I serve with Asparagus Au Gratin?
This dish pairs excellently with lemon-roasted chicken, grilled fish, or a hearty salad for a beautiful meal.
